Regulatory Impact Statements

Regulatory Impact Statements are produced when significant subordinate legislation is developed.

Regulatory impact statements:

  • explain why subordinate legislation is needed
  • outline the costs and benefits associated with the subordinate legislation

All Regulatory Impact Statements must be open to public comment for at least 28 days. By commenting on a Regulatory Impact Statement, you are participating in the legislative development process and providing valuable feedback to the Department of Justice and Attorney-General.
